What is a Laser Rust Removal Machine?
A Laser Rust Removal Machine uses high-intensity laser beams to remove rust, oxidation, and other contaminants from metal surfaces without damaging the underlying material. The technology works by directing focused laser pulses onto the rusty surface. The intense heat generated by the laser causes the rust to vaporize or break away, leaving behind a clean, smooth surface.
Unlike traditional methods, the laser treatment is non-abrasive, ensuring that the underlying material remains intact. This makes it suitable for even the most delicate surfaces, where traditional methods could cause damage or wear. The precision of the laser allows for fine-tuned rust removal, eliminating unwanted materials without affecting the base metal.
Why Choose Laser Rust Removal Machines?
Eco-Friendly and Safe: Traditional rust removal methods often involve harmful chemicals, abrasive materials, and potentially hazardous procedures. Laser rust removal is environmentally friendly, as it doesn’t use chemicals or create waste products like sand or abrasive materials. Additionally, it is safe for workers, as there are no toxic fumes or dust to worry about.
High Efficiency and Speed: The Laser Rust Removal Machine provides fast, efficient results, reducing labor time and increasing productivity. It can clean large surface areas in a fraction of the time compared to traditional methods, making it ideal for industrial applications where time is a critical factor.
Precision Cleaning: The laser technology is highly accurate, allowing for precise rust removal even on intricate or detailed metal surfaces. It ensures that only the rust is removed, leaving the underlying material intact. This makes it perfect for delicate surfaces like machinery parts, sculptures, and automotive components.
Cost-Effective in the Long Run: While the initial investment in a laser rust removal machine might be higher than traditional methods, the long-term savings are significant. The machine requires minimal maintenance, and the reduction in labor and material costs over time makes it a cost-effective choice.
Minimal Surface Damage: Since the laser process is non-abrasive, there is no risk of causing scratches, pits, or other surface damage. This is crucial for industries where maintaining the integrity of the surface is essential, such as aerospace, automotive, and manufacturing.
Applications of Laser Rust Removal Machines
Laser rust removal is versatile and can be used in various industries, including:
- Automotive: Restoration of car parts, engines, and body panels.
- Manufacturing: Maintenance and cleaning of metal tools, machinery, and production lines.
- Marine Industry: Removal of rust from boats, ships, and other marine equipment.
- Aerospace: Maintenance of aircraft components, ensuring optimal performance and safety.
